Acquisition of power demand

Values that can be read out
The power monitoring devices supply the power demand of the last completed demand
period:
● Average values for active power and reactive power, separated in each case for import
and export
● Minimum and maximum within the period
● Length of the demand period in seconds. The period may be shorter due to external
synchronization.
● Time in seconds since the last synchronization or since completion of the last period
Note
The power demand can only be read out via the interface (it is not shown on the display).
The average values of the last demand period can only be retrieved during the active
demand period.
Example: Period length and length of the demand period
Period length: 15 min; time of day: 13:03; time in seconds: 180 s.
The following can be calculated from this: The last demand period ended at 13:00. The
active demand period will end at 13:15 or in 12 min.
Adjustable parameters
● Time interval in minutes: 1 to 60 min adjustable, default 15 min
● Synchronization via bus or digital input

Energy counters

Energy counters
The power monitoring devices have energy counters for recording
● Active energy import
● Active energy export
● Reactive energy import
● Reactive energy export
● Apparent energy
